      <description>Hi all,&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;I am trying to change the SNMP strings on my servers to new, long, complex passphrases.  I want to use the "Replicate Agent Settings" function of SIM, but I'm running into a snag.  &l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Every time I change the SNMP strings on a server, and try to use that server as a replication target, "HP Foundation Agent" is no longer listed on the "Step 3: Choose Source Configuration Settings" screen.  (See the attached bitmap.)  Therefore I can't choose the SNMP strings as a replication option.  I've seen this consistently on three different servers.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Is this a bug?  Does anyone have an explanation for it?&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;I would use the "Configure and Repair Agents" function, but that in fact will add a new community string, not change the existing one.  You also cannot specify the READ-CREATE string using that function.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Thanks,&lt;BR /&gt;- Steve&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;</description>

      <description>Well, after much tedious experimentation, I've solved this mystery.  It seems that Systems Insight Manager doesn't support the character '&amp;amp;' in an SNMP string.  It's supported by Windows, but it breaks the "Replicate Agent Settings" function.  As soon as I replaced it with another character, everything worked again.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;I also have the '@' and '!' characters in strings but they don't seem to bother it!&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;- Steve&lt;BR /&gt;</description>
